Step-by-Step Guide

Here are some simple steps to determine if someone has blocked your number:

  1. Check if the person is still in your contacts. If not, try adding them back and see if you are able to.
  2. Try calling the person. If your call immediately goes to voicemail every time you try, this may indicate that you have been blocked.
  3. Try sending a text message. If the message appears as “sent” but not “delivered” or does not show a “delivered” timestamp, this may be a sign that you have been blocked.
  4. Check for the status of your previous iMessages. If they are shown as “delivered” but not “read,” this may indicate that you have been blocked.
  5. Look for the person’s last active status on apps like iMessage or WhatsApp. If their status has not changed in a while, this may indicate that they have blocked you.
  6. Try calling the person from a different number or phone to see if your calls still go to voicemail.
  7. Check if the person’s phone is turned off or in airplane mode. This can cause your calls and texts to go straight to voicemail or not be delivered.
  8. Ask a mutual friend if they have heard from the person recently, which can help confirm whether or not you have been blocked.

Alternate Methods

If the above methods do not work or if you want to try a different approach, here are some alternate methods:

  • Text the person from a different number to see if they respond. If they do, this indicates that they may have blocked your original number.
  • Install a third-party app to call or message the person, such as WhatsApp or Viber. If you are able to contact them through these apps, they may have blocked your original number.
  • Attempt to FaceTime the person. If the call goes through but immediately ends, this may indicate that you have been blocked.

Signs to Look For

Here are some subtle hints that someone may have blocked your number on iPhone:

  • You never receive a response to your calls or texts.
  • You are unable to leave a voicemail.
  • You hear a busy sound when calling or a “call failed” message after a few rings.
  • The person’s last seen status on messaging apps has not changed in a while.
  • You are unable to add them back on social media or other apps.
